The Statue of Peace, located within the serene surroundings of Swoyambhunath, is a significant historical landmark that draws tourists seeking both beauty and tranquility. This impressive statue, which stands tall against the backdrop of the enthralling Kathmandu Valley, symbolizes the hope for peace and harmony among all beings. Visitors are often captivated by the majestic figure, which offers not just a visual treat but also a profound sense of calmness. The temple complex surrounding the statue is one of the oldest in Nepal, adding layers of historical significance to your visit. As you walk around the site, take a moment to absorb the spiritual atmosphere and the breathtaking views of the valley below. The Swoyambhunath area is also known for its rich biodiversity, including playful monkeys that roam freely, adding a unique charm to the experience. Visitors are encouraged to be mindful of their belongings, especially food items, as the monkeys are known to be curious and occasionally mischievous. The pathways leading up to the statue are lined with prayer flags fluttering in the wind, creating a vibrant and colorful ambiance that enhances the overall experience. While exploring, don’t forget to observe the intricate carvings and statues that tell stories of the local culture and religion. The Statue of Peace stands as a beacon of hope, inviting tourists to reflect on the importance of peace in today’s world.

Local tips

  • Visit early in the morning for fewer crowds and a peaceful experience.
  • Dress modestly, as this is a spiritual site.
  • Be cautious of monkeys; keep your food and valuables secure.
  • Take time to explore the surrounding temple complex for a full experience of the area.
  • Bring a camera to capture the stunning views of Kathmandu Valley.
